 Around the World in 80 Minutes

80 Minutes, 10 Musicians, 14 Songs. Irama Tanah Air (ITA) will take you on a whirlwind world tour through music, journeying from Asia to Scandinavia, South America to the Middle East, and more. Titled Around the World in 80 Minutes, the performance promises us 14 local and global pieces - some classics, some brand new -  by six different musical arrangers. We speak to Bernard Goh, the Founder & Artistic Director of both Hands Percussion and Irama Tanah Air, to discover what's in store at this musical concert.
